Grant disappointed by script-writing failure

16/11/2004 - 10:40:56
British hunk Hugh Grant is disappointed he hasn't fulfilled his dream of writing a "brilliant script", despite entering semi-retirement.

The 44-year-old has taken small parts in movies like Bridget Jones: The Edge of Reason and Love, Actually to give him more time to pen a small independent movie, but he admits he's still waiting for inspiration.

He complains: "I am sort of semi-retired. I did a smallish role in Love, Actually and a smallish role in the new Bridget Jones film, but I'm not in any hurry to sit in big development meetings and make great big commercial films.

"I do have a touch of apathy about that now. I keep thinking I'll use the time to write a brilliant script. But I've done b**ger all."
